I bet over 90% of addicts aren't able to taper but that still leaves quite a few that are able to. Just because ct worked for one doesn't mean it's the best choice for all.
My opinion for tapering is to give it a try but the second you veer off that taper, flush them and go ct. It's all too easy to talk ourselves into taking one extra for today because we have this or that going on. It normally ends up being an everyday thing though. But, if you are able to stick to that taper then I feel that is the way to go. I've tapered in the past and got through with little to no withdrawal. It takes so much discipline which is normally something us addicts don't have. Later on down the road I wasn't able to taper and had to bite the bullet. We have to remember that everyone is at different stages of addiction and they might not be in so deep to where they aren't able to make a taper work.
